 Bhel Puri

INGREDIENTS

2 boiled potatoes
1 cup puffed rice (Pori in Tamil)
A pnch turmeric
powder

For Omapodi :
1.5 cups besan flour
½ rice flour
Salt, hing
½ tsp chilli powder
Oil

For Sweet Chutney :
Tamarind ping pong ball size (soaked in warm water)
3 to 4 tsp jaggery
2 Dates (optional) (seeds removed after soaking in warm water)

For Green Chutney :
A small bunch coriander leaves
½ bunch mint leaves
1 or 2 green chillies
Salt (very little)

For red chutney :
1 big tomato
½ onion
¼ tsp saunf
Salt (very little)

For Garnishing :
Slices of Onion
Slices of Tomato
Coriander leaves chopped
Chat Masala powder - a pinch

 

bhel puri

METHOD
Prepare Omapodi by mixing all the above ingredients with little water into a stiff dough and then by passing them into hot oil through a presser with small holes. Remove and drain when fried. Grind sweet chutney with ingredients mentioned above by adding water. Grind green chutney with ingredients mentioned above by adding water. Grind red chutney with ingredients mentioned above by adding water. Now take a bowl add Pori, Smashed potatoes, Omapodi (broken to very small pieces) turmeric powder and mix well. When well mixed, pour all chutneys one by one mixing very well. Finally garnish with above mentioned items. Transfer to serving plate and serve immediately else it will become soggy.
